SAP® Carbon Impact OnDemand Goes Global

Autodesk, Arch Chemicals and Fisker Automotive to Use SaaS Offering from SAP to Profitably Reduce Their Energy and Carbon Footprint Worldwide

Software Accelerates Credible Reporting in a Multi-Lingual, Global Economy With Enhanced Data Integration Across the Enterprise and Product Supply Chains


News provided by

SAP AG

Sep 20, 2010, 09:00 ET

Share this article

Share toX

Share this article

Share toX

WALLDORF, Germany, Sept. 20 /PRNewswire/ -- SAP AG (NYSE: SAP) introduced an enhanced version of the SAP® Carbon Impact OnDemand solution to help companies profitably reduce their energy and carbon footprint across their entire operations and product supply chains worldwide. Designed for the global economy, companies can rely on SAP Carbon Impact OnDemand 5.0 to help credibly report, analyze and reduce their worldwide energy and greenhouse gas emissions in the most cost-effective way. The software enables companies to adapt their carbon reduction strategy to the swiftly changing global market environments, characterized by volatile energy prices and tightening regulations, such as the introduction of the U.S. EPA Mandatory Reporting Rule.

SAP Carbon Impact OnDemand helps alleviate the rising global pressure on companies to address the costs of energy and carbon by offering the following benefits - without any software installation requirements:

  • Establish a credible inventory and benchmark of a company's global environmental performance across all facilities with the option to obtain language support for more than 50 countries—among the broadest multi-language support in the industry
  • Significantly help reduce reporting costs, improve data accuracy and shorten reporting cycles by automating data collection from multiple sources and systems, including metering systems, utilities, third-party applications and the on-premise enterprise resource planning (ERP) application SAP® ERP
  • Support in achieving consistent cost savings by developing the optimal strategy for energy and emissions reduction for both the entire company and global product supply chains based on financial and operational parameters
  • Accelerate achievement of internal sustainability goals by engaging the global workforce to drive change toward a more sustainable enterprise with collaboration and rewards programs

SAP Carbon Impact OnDemand is the first SAP solution developed to run natively in the cloud, delivering on the traditional benefits of on-demand software—such as getting users up and running instantly and delivering measurable cost advantages—while extending these benefits even further. SAP is able to provide the seamless integration to existing SAP on-premise software investments, as well as to help ensure consistency in: governance and solution lifecycle management; master and meta data management; process integrity; security; application extensibility; and usability. With SAP on-demand technologies, every aspect of the application, such as user interface and data model, is extensible both at the design time and run time; these extensions are promptly visible in the application. SAP fully leverages the public cloud and therefore the cost of scaling the infrastructure as the business grows is truly flexible.

Credible Reporting as Basis for Successful Global Energy and Carbon Footprint Reduction

Supporting the multifaceted environment in which global companies operate, SAP Carbon Impact OnDemand 5.0 helps businesses provide an auditable calculation of their global energy and carbon inventories. They can confidently report to carbon registries and regulatory authorities worldwide, such as the Carbon Disclosure Project and the U.S. Environmental Protection Agency (EPA). Additionally, the new version of SAP Carbon Impact OnDemand helps companies establish a systematic approach to reducing their global energy and carbon footprint—with a clear focus on cost reduction. The solution offers benchmarking capabilities, analytical tools and best-practices content. For example, by using the solution's new facilities energy management capability, companies can establish a credible inventory and benchmark energy data across all global facilities. In addition, product lifecycle analysis capabilities help companies obtain an enriched product footprint assessment to identify immediate areas of improvement for their carbon reduction strategy.

Engaging the Global Workforce Leads Change Toward Sustainability

A highly engaged global workforce is an integral part of a company achieving its overall sustainability goal. Thus the new version of SAP Carbon Impact OnDemand extends the insights about a company's carbon and energy intensity across all organization levels. The software allows companies to add on language support via an upcoming service pack for more than 50 countries in order to engage with employees in their native language. Companies can also set in place incentive programs that reward employees for their individual contributions to attain corporate sustainability objectives. Social collaboration technology helps companies to engage with employees and suppliers and drive change toward a more sustainable enterprise.

SAP Uses SAP Carbon Impact OnDemand for Quarterly Sustainability Reports

To set an example of how a global company can operate successfully and responsibly by running on SAP software, SAP is using SAP Carbon Impact OnDemand 5.0 to analyze its own energy use and the impact on its global carbon footprint. The solution helped SAP identify key areas for implementing carbon-efficient operations, including travel, data centers, buildings and commitment to renewable energy. Moreover, SAP was able to shorten the reporting cycle for its sustainability reporting. In early 2010, SAP introduced quarterly sustainability updates to complement the company's annual sustainability report.
